Chili and Spice Rubbed Pork Tenderloin

Mashed Sweet Potatoes and Steamed Green Beans
Clock

Ingredients

  • 1 pork tenderloin, trimmed (about 1 lb)
  • 1 Tbsp Mexican seasoning (or use fajita seasoning)
  • 1 Tbsp olive oil
  • 1 Tbsp honey
  • ½ Tbsp fresh lime juice

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F. Rub pork with seasoning.
  2. Cook pork in hot oil in a large ovenproof skillet over medium-high heat 4 minutes per side or until browned. Transfer skillet to oven.
  3. Bake 10 minutes or until a meat thermometer inserted reads 145°F. Let stand 3 minutes before slicing.
  4. Stir together honey and lime juice; drizzle over pork.

Side Dish Ingredients

  • 1 lb sweet potatoes, peeled and cubed
  • 3 Tbsp butter
  • ¼ tsp ground cinnamon
  • ½ (12-oz) pkg frozen green beans

Side Dish Instructions

  1. Cook potatoes in boiling water to cover in a Dutch oven until tender; drain and mash to desired consistency with butter and cinnamon.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  2. Steam green beans according to package directions.
